What Is a Robot Vacuum and Mop with Self Emptying?
Let’s start with the basics.
A robot vacuum and mop with self emptying is an automated cleaning device that combines vacuuming and mopping in one system. What sets it apart from standard robot vacuums is its self-emptying functionality. After cleaning, it automatically returns to a docking station where it empties collected dust, debris, and sometimes dirty water—reducing how often you need to interact with it.
This kind of robot is designed to handle both dry and wet messes and is especially useful for busy households, pet owners, or anyone looking to minimize daily chores.
Key Features to Understand
Want to know what makes these devices tick? Here are the core components and features that define this type of robot cleaner:
1. Dual Cleaning Modes
The robot typically includes:
-
A suction system for vacuuming dust, pet hair, and debris
-
A water tank and mop pad system for wiping floors
These two functions can work simultaneously or separately, depending on the model and settings.
2. Self-Emptying Base Station
Here’s where the real innovation happens.
After completing a cleaning cycle, the robot docks itself onto a base station. The base features a motorized vacuum system that pulls debris from the robot’s dustbin into a larger storage bag or bin. This allows the robot to be ready for the next cycle without manual intervention.
3. Smart Navigation and Mapping
These devices come equipped with sensors, cameras, or LiDAR technology to:
-
Map your home
-
Detect obstacles
-
Create efficient cleaning paths
Advanced models can even identify different floor types and adjust suction or mopping pressure accordingly.
4. App Control and Voice Commands
Most units are compatible with smartphone apps, allowing users to:
-
Schedule cleaning times
-
View maps of cleaned areas
-
Customize zones and no-go zones
Some models also support voice assistants like Alexa or Google Assistant for hands-free control.
Why Self-Emptying Is a Game Changer
Let’s face it—emptying a dustbin after every cleaning session is tedious. With a vacuum cleaner self cleaning system, you can avoid this daily task altogether. The self-emptying base typically holds enough dirt and debris to last for weeks, depending on the size of your home and how frequently you run the robot.
This feature is especially beneficial for:
-
People with allergies (less exposure to dust)
-
Pet owners (more frequent cleaning without added effort)
-
Anyone seeking a more hygienic and convenient solution
The Mop Function: Not Just an Afterthought
Unlike basic vacuum-only robots, these hybrid machines also tackle sticky messes and fine dust. The mop system usually includes:
-
A water reservoir or an electronic water pump
-
Washable or disposable mop pads
-
Adjustable water flow settings
Some advanced systems even return to the dock to wash and dry the mop pads automatically. This turns your robot into a vacuum that cleans itself, which further reduces maintenance.

Considerations Before Getting One
Even though these devices are efficient, they aren’t completely maintenance-free. Here are a few things to keep in mind:
1. Floor Type Compatibility
Some mopping systems aren’t ideal for carpeted areas. Look for models that can detect and avoid rugs during the mopping process.
2. Docking Space
The self-emptying base is larger than standard docks. Make sure you have enough floor space for installation.
3. Ongoing Maintenance
You’ll still need to:
-
Replace dust bags in the base station
-
Refill the water tank
-
Clean or replace mop pads
Although the effort is minimal, it’s not entirely hands-off.
Environmental and Noise Impact
Modern models are increasingly eco-conscious. Many come with:
-
Reusable mop pads
-
Energy-efficient designs
-
Quiet operation modes for nighttime cleaning
Still, the self-emptying mechanism can be loud during the debris transfer process, though this lasts only a few seconds.
